How to Start the Import Export Business

Entering the import export business isn't a game of chance. It's a matter of understanding your market, finding solid partners, and ensuring that every step is backed up by law. Follow this straightforward, realistic guide to establish your trade company and begin crossing borders with confidence.

1. Research and Choose Your Product(s)

Bury yourself in market data to identify products with consistent global demand and decent margins. Research trade reports, attend trade shows, government export websites, and export directories to monitor what's hot. Watch out for seasonal spikes, tariff benefits, and specialized items that are less competitive but with strong buying interest. The correct decision here determines the course of your business.

2. Create a Business Plan

A solid business plan is more than paperwork. It's your game plan combined with business skills. Define your target markets, product line, price points, and distribution channels. Include shipping fees, tax, and currency exchange in order to maintain profitability. Plan both short-term growth objectives and long-term expansion objectives, so you can switch gears when opportunities or setbacks come up.

3. Register Your Business

Get the official papers to trade lawfully. In a majority of nations, that entails obtaining your IEC (Import Export Code) and registering your business in the proper business category. This action also involves creating a business address that is lawful and a special trade account in order to keep your finances as clean and compliant as possible.

Each target market has its own regulations. From labeling to restricted goods lists. Master each country's import and export rules. Construct a checklist for customs procedures and clearance, product certifications, and import/export business documentation and licenses to ensure you stay clear of expensive delays at the border.

5. Find Reliable Suppliers and Buyers

Intense relationships fuel regular trade. Collaborate with local producers for sourcing and screen them through site visits or third-party audits. From the buyer's side, use trade fairs, online B2B marketplaces, and export promotion agencies to identify serious, long-term partners who can execute repeat orders.

6. Arrange Logistics and Shipping

Shipping is the lifeblood of your business. Select logistics partners that have expertise in customs clearance, warehousing, and last-mile delivery. Shop around for freight forwarding companies on cost, transit time, and dependability. Having the right logistics infrastructure keeps your supply chain flowing and prevents bottlenecks that devour profits.

7. Manage Finances and Payments

Global trade involves handling several currencies, taxes, and payment terms. Employ safe payment methods such as escrow or confirmed letters of credit to safeguard transactions. Deal with banks or fintech platforms that provide low currency exchange commissions. Maintain transparent accounting for tax purposes and future investment prospects.

FAQs

1. What are the most demanded import-export products?

Best-selling import export items are electronics, organic foodstuff, cosmetics, renewable energy devices, and luxury items. Market trends shift rapidly, so update trade reports and consumer demand statistics frequently. Winners monitor fast-breaking categories ahead of time, shift their portfolio quickly, and employ stable sourcing vehicles to lead the way on changing global purchasing trends.

2. How much does it cost to start an import-export business?

You can start a small import export business startup cost with a few thousand dollars if operating at home with little stock and web-based platforms. Bigger bulk trade operations require higher amounts of capital for inventory, warehousing, and freight. Budget for marketing, insurance, and legal requirements in all cases, as these unforeseen costs will greatly burden your initial investment.

3. Can I start an import-export business from home?

Yes, there is a possibility of operating an import export business from home with a laptop, internet, and consistent suppliers. Utilize freight forwarders for shipping and sell products on B2B platforms or online stores. Establish trust with buyers via open communication, professional branding, and regular order fulfillment to compete favorably with larger, long-established trading firms.

4. What are the risks in import-export business?

Import export risks are currency fluctuations, trade regulation changes, untrustworthy suppliers, and geopolitical tension. Demand shifts can be a disruption to profitability as well. Limit risk by diversifying suppliers, obtaining written contracts, and keeping abreast of economic trends in targeted markets. A reliable contingency plan keeps your business running even when unforeseen problems hit global supply and demand.

5. How to manage customs duties and taxes?

Understand the import regulations of every destination ahead of shipping. Have precise product descriptions, HS codes, and invoices on hand. Use a reputable customs broker to deal with local regulations. Compliance prevents delays, penalties, and confiscation. Tracking duty changes in your markets of opportunity keeps your import export processes cost-effective and competitive without compromising delivery times.
